Type Alias window::FramebufferRef

source ·
pub type FramebufferRef<'g> = DerefsTo<MutexGuard<'g, WindowInner>, Framebuffer<AlphaPixel>>;
Expand description

A wrapper around a locked inner window that immutably derefs to a Framebuffer.

The lock is auto-released when this object is dropped.

Aliased Type§

struct FramebufferRef<'g> { /* private fields */ }

Trait Implementations§

source§

impl<Inner, Ref> Deref for DerefsTo<Inner, Ref>where Ref: ?Sized,

§

type Target = Ref

The resulting type after dereferencing.
source§

fn deref(&self) -> &<DerefsTo<Inner, Ref> as Deref>::Target

Dereferences the value.